An extremely rare baseball card featuring a 19-year-old Babe Ruth has sold for $7.2 million at auction - the third-highest sum in trading ...A 1914 Baltimore News Babe Ruth rookie card sold for $7.2 million, including the buyer's premium, just after midnight Monday, the third highest sum ever paid for a sports card. It narrowly missed the $7.25 million paid for a T206 Sweet Caporal Honus Wagner card in August 2022. It's the most expensive Ruth item of all-time.

1933 R338 Goudey Sport Kings Gum #2 Babe Ruth. Arguably one of the best designs from Babe Ruth's playing days, 1933 Sport Kings includes 18 different sports in its varied checklist, with only three baseball players. Like 1933 Goudey, the Sport Kings card showcases a colorful and detailed sketch of Ruth, with a light green background.

The 1914 Baltimore Sun Babe Ruth card recently sold for …The iconic 1933 set of baseball cards issued by the Goudey Card Company includes four Babe Ruth cards. The #53 card, which is also known as the “Yellow Ruth,” is the most cherished because it is the most difficult to obtain in good condition. The Yellow Ruth that sold for $4.2 million in July 2021 was considered to be in top condition ...
